Nature and Complexity of Corruption Litigation
Corruption matters are distinct from routine criminal cases due to their technical and procedural nature. These cases commonly include allegations such as:
-
Demand or acceptance of illegal gratification
-
Abuse of official authority
-
Disproportionate assets cases
-
Criminal conspiracy involving public servants and private individuals
-
Procedural violations during investigation
Investigations are generally conducted by specialized agencies such as the Anti-Corruption Bureau (ACB) or CBI, and trials are held before Special Courts, with critical legal challenges addressed by the Rajasthan High Court.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1. What makes corruption cases legally challenging?
They involve technical evidence, sanction requirements, constitutional issues, and strict procedural compliance, making expert legal handling essential.
Q2. Can a senior advocate challenge false corruption allegations?
Yes. Senior advocates can challenge illegal investigations, defective FIRs, lack of sanction, and procedural violations before the High Court.
Q3. Is bail difficult in corruption cases?
Bail depends on facts, evidence, and judicial discretion. Experienced senior advocates are skilled in presenting strong bail arguments.
Q4. Can private individuals be prosecuted under corruption laws?
Yes. Private parties involved in conspiracy or financial transactions can be prosecuted along with public servants.
